Output e22994d26640d39bbf9df4cb00a3215ec21a7e9f543f3f6052ea1852c95e3e41:1

value
6221827
script pubkey
OP_0 OP_PUSHBYTES_20 e8840d8d7645a475ea50f99938a534bc13ea78c5
address
bc1qazzqmrtkgkj8t6jslxvn3ff5hsf757x9d5hqfs
transaction
e22994d26640d39bbf9df4cb00a3215ec21a7e9f543f3f6052ea1852c95e3e41
confirmations
25766
spent
true